Cristiano Ronaldo has praised Arsenal’s new signing Viktor Gyökeres, calling him a “special player.”

Gyökeres forced the move by refusing to train with Sporting, and he arrives in North London with high expectations after netting 97 goals in 102 matches for the Portuguese side.
He leaves Sporting on a high, having played a key role in their league and cup double triumph last season.
Ronaldo, who launched his career at Sporting before moving to Manchester United in the early 2000s, believes the club will continue to thrive even after losing their star forward.
‘I hope it’s a competitive league. I always hope for the best and that Sporting can be champions again,’ Ronaldo said.
‘We only miss those who are there, that’s what they say. I believe Sporting will be competitive.
‘Gyokeres was a special player, but the team will have to adapt.
‘I believe [Luis] Suarez, who arrived from Almeria, is an excellent forward. [Conrad] Harder is also a good player, young, and needs time.
‘I watched the Super Cup, Sporting performed well against Benfica but they didn’t win because they couldn’t, that’s football.’
